Oedipus – Old Vic
Hollywood star and Oscar winner Rami Malek plays Oedipus opposite Olivier Award winner Indira Varma as Jocasta. Hofesh Shechter and Matthew Warchus co-direct Ella Hickson’s new version of Sophocles’ ancient Greek tragedy, the former directing the dance elements and the latter the drama.
Shakespeare’s Cymbeline at the Candlelit Sam Wanamaker Playhouse
If ‘Shakespeare’s Plays’ was a topic on ‘Pointless’, Cymbeline might just be a winning answer. This production, at the 340-seat Sam Wanamaker Playhouse, was enough to convince me that’s an ill-deserved state of affairs – it’s a play that deserves to be better known.
The Little Foxes
‘There are people who must finish what they start and not look back, and I am one of those people,’ declares Regina Giddens (Anne-Marie Duff) towards the end of The Little Foxes. While the play is set in America’s South in 1900, it felt like a line that could have been spoken by Lady Macbeth.
